ID: 63814303 Shift: 21:00-07:00 Description: Description:Monday to ThursdayMUST HAVE NH LICENSE - CERTIFICATION IN HAND PRIOR TO SUBMISSION Unit Information: Ultrasound Location: Catholic Medical Center Address: 100 McGregor St. Manchester, NH 03102 Floor: Level A Radiology Building: 78 General Information Tell us about the unit(s): Number of Beds - 4 ultrasound rooms Number of Staff 14 Type of staff: o Day Shift 4 sonographers staffed (plus supervisor) o Second shift- 1 sonographer staffed after 7:30p o Night Shift 1 sonographer staffed Patient Ratios 8-10 in an 8 hour shift Type of equipment Siemens Acuson S200 & GE Logiq E10 EMR Allscripts PACS- InteleRad Patient Population - pedi to geriatric Typical hiring profile Skill Set Most recruited for: At least one year of experience with a wide array of exposure to various types of ultrasound, a good track record with past employers, and positive references Must have: candidates without these skills will not be considered for the role. Knowledge of anatomy and pathology with ability to recognize normal from abnormal findings Basic scanning skills with good understanding of sonographic physics and techniques Clinical experience in a hospital or acute care setting- with some exposure to general, vascular, & OB-GYN sonography Preferred or nice to have: candidates with these skills will be considered first. Additional certifications: RVT, OB-GYN, AB Experience in the OR and with ultrasound procedures 1 year of experience beyond education List typical procedures performed on unit(s): Thoras, paras, FNAs (thyroids, parotids, lymph nodes), soft tissue masses or lymph node BXs, liver & renal BXs, drainages (abscesses, cysts, hematomas, gallbladders), thrombin injections, etc OR- breast needle placements, carotids, D&Cs, prostate BXs Best personality Fit: Hard working, willing to learn, motivated self starter, fast learner, considerate of others, compassionate patient care, can work on a team and independently, willing to teach, does not engage in gossip, able to communicate with management appropriately, willing to adhere to dept policies REQUIRED CERTIFICATIONS: BLS, RDMS, NH MIRT Licensure Floating Area(s): Opportunities for extra shifts within the dept. If Breast ultrasound desired- BCC may have opportunities Dress Code: Scrub Color/Attire - Any color professional, clean appearing scrubs or radiology themed t shirts Unit Guidelines/Policies: Please feel free to attach unit policies and guidelines. Attendance and PTO request policies must be followed, all exam protocols need to be adhered to Weekends and On-call (if any) Weekends covered by weekend position staff. No call- call tree implemented for permanent FT staff for critical staffing needs General Comments No. of Positions: 1/1. Guaranteed Hours: 36 Contract Weeks:91
